    I have driven past this place many times. This was my first visit into this establishment. At first glance, the shop was not what I expected. I felt excited when I walked in. The smells, sights were all teasing me to look all over the restaurant. They have a menu on the wall with pictures so you can see and read a large variety of options. It was hard to choose. It was a pricier per person eatery. Coat me and hubby $30 for our meals that you do have to pay for a drink on the side. I love love the soda machine. You can pick a base flavor of soda and have flavors added. All the tables where clean, and my only complaint was the trash was an open giant rolling bin that was full. My lunch was creamy garlic tortallini. Had fresh not frozen veggies and spinach. Will def go again.

    I am currently addicted to stuffed kinds of pasta. Before, it was the Asian-inspired pasta. You can substitute noodles with vegetables like zoodles or cauliflower options. Lately, they seem to be busy with many online, curbside, and pick-up orders. The staff has always been polite. If you order extra meat, you will get it. If you order extra sauce, it seems they monitor your cholesterol, lol, and I should be grateful. I usually get the roasted garlic cream sauce which is deliciously decadent. I can feel the calories running to my waist and thighs. I ordered the 3-cheese Tortellini Rosa this time with meatballs. I didn't need the meatballs. It was good with a bit of spice. The last time I ordered it for my daughter, it was too much for her, and she felt the chicken was dry. Everyone else in my household loves the marinated steak. I recommend ordering online or calling. If there's a problem, management has been receptive to quick resolutions.

    We came in right as they opened, and they had several soups not ready for purchase. The employee that took our order was super friendly and helpful in recommending dishes as we were first time customers; even helped with setting up our rewards account to get us a free rice crispy treat (it was ridiculously huge! Feed all 3 of my kids). I got the Alfredo dish, and it was very tasty. Only complaint would be that the chicken was super thin, and however they cook it left it very dry. Kids meals were of substantial size. The restaurant was super clean, and it appeared that they had one employee dedicated to ensuring tables stayed cleaned up as well as the soda station area. Overall, decent food and quality for the price but make sure you come super hungry due to portion sizes. We could have dropped two of our entrees and had enough for everyone to eat and leave full.

    I'll start by saying that I never planned to step foot in an Olive Garden again. I'm part Italian…read moreand have eaten at many Italian places, and somehow Olive Garden has become a thin veneer of a mockery of Italian cuisine in my eyes. So I also never expected that I'd be giving this one three stars even. In part, because they were able to seat our party of 5 pretty quickly, and the service was really good. They even didn't try to pass off the soft Romano as "Parmesan", but did have those graters always at the ready to offer more cheese. The ambiance - well, it's Olive Garden. There was a gas fireplace in the room we were in, but it wasn't lit at the time (June, in Jacksonville, NC, there would be no reason to). There's some faux stonework, but generally the space is forgettable. The food - I had the Minestrone (which the waitstaff mispronounced, without the final "e"). This soup is arguably an Olive Garden strength. It's pretty authentic in the ingredients, and the soups are made locally fresh. I also had the Chicken Alfredo. This is so far beyond Alfredo di Lelio's original recipe, it probably shouldn't be called that. Just call it "chicken fettuccine in a garlic cream sauce with broccoli as an option". I did get the broccoli also. That was blanched well and still firm but good when in the dish. There was a decent amount of a heavy garlic cream sauce and the pasta was ... OK. In past OG visits the pasta was clearly as if it had been pulled from a microwave. This was better than that, but still not amazing. The chicken was nearly undercooked. It was just enough that I trusted to eat it, but the staff definitely need to pay attention to that. Let's talk about those breadsticks. These of course are a selling point of OG, with bottomless breadsticks and the flavorless, nutrition-less cores of so much iceberg lettuce in the bowl they call "salad". The part that sells the bread is the brushed butter substance and the dusting of cheese, lending salt to the flavor as well. But as far as "bread" it's a spongy soft mess. I went because family wanted to, and I was polite and went with it. But I'd wager you can find even better Italian.
